Setting the Stage: AI Strategies in State and Local Government

The emergence of federal policies surrounding the use of artificial intelligence in government has inspired state and local leaders to develop, align and execute their own AI strategies. By crafting guidelines around responsible and ethical AI usage, public sector teams are striking the right balance between AI governance and adoption to transform their workforce. A strategic AI framework, as well as safeguards around privacy and cybersecurity, allow agencies to automate tedious tasks, enhance productivity and advance digital transformation. How else can a robust AI strategy open the door to focusing on more meaningful work?
